Chicken

Ingredients

To create this delicious Chicken Corn Chowder, gather the following ingredients:

For the Base

  • 4 strips Turkey Beef bacon chopped
  • 1 small yellow onion diced
  • 2 celery stalks ch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ves minced
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our

For the Soup

  • 3 cups chicken broth
  • 2 cups diced Yukon Gold potatoes
  • 1/2 tsp dried thyme
  • 1/2 tsp dried parsley
  • Salt and pepper to taste

For the Finish

  • 1 1/2 cups cooked shredded chicken
  • 1 1/2 cups corn fresh, frozen, or canned
  • 1 cup half & half
  • 1/3 cup sour cream

How to Make Chicken Corn Chowder

Step 1: Cook the Turkey Beef bacon

  • In a large pot over medium heat, cook the turkey Beef bacon until crispy.
  • Once cooked, remove from the pot and set aside.

Step 2: Sauté Vegetables

  • In the same pot using the rendered fat from the turkey Beef bacon, add diced onion, chopped celery, and minced garlic.
  • Sauté until softened and fragrant.

Step 3: Add Flour and Broth

  • Stir in all-purpose flour until fully combined.
  • Gradually add chicken broth while stirring to avoid lumps.

Step 4: Incorporate Potatoes and Herbs

  • Add diced Yukon Gold potatoes along with dried thyme and parsley.
  • Simmer for about 15 minutes or until potatoes are tender.

Step 5: Mix in Chicken and Corn

  • Stir in shredded chicken and corn.
  • Cook for an additional 5–7 minutes until heated through.

Step 6: Add Creamy Elements

  • Reduce heat to low.
  • Add half & half and sour cream into the chowder slowly while stirring gently.

Enjoy your homemade Chicken Corn Chowder! This recipe serves six hearty bowls ideal for sharing or meal prepping for the week ahead.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When making Chicken Corn Chowder, it’s easy to overlook some key steps. Here are common mistakes to avoid for the best results.

  • Using too much flour: Adding excess flour can make your chowder overly thick. Use 1/4 cup for a creamy texture without heaviness.
  • Not seasoning properly: Insufficient seasoning can lead to bland chowder. Taste as you go and adjust salt and pepper for flavor enhancement.
  • Skipping the sautéing step: Sautéing the vegetables releases their flavors. Always sauté onions, celery, and garlic before adding other ingredients.
  • Overcooking the potatoes: Cooking potatoes too long can make them mushy. Simmer just until tender for the perfect bite in your chowder.
  • Ignoring ingredient temperature: Adding cold ingredients can cool down your chowder. Use room temperature chicken and broth for better consistency.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store in an airtight container.
  • Keep in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Freezing Chicken Corn Chowder

  • Freeze in freezer-safe containers or bags.
  • It will last up to 3 months in the freezer.

Reheating Chicken Corn Chowder

  •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C). Place chowder in an oven-safe dish covered with foil; heat for 20-30 minutes until warm.
  • Microwave: Heat in a microwave-safe bowl, covered lightly. Warm in short bursts of 1-2 minutes, stirring between each burst.
  • Stovetop: Pour into a saucepan over medium heat. Stir occasionally until heated through, about 5-10 minutes.
